diff --git a/examples/hello-uniapp/common/uni.css b/examples/hello-uniapp/common/uni.css
index b20ccf5945fa65b3478027a37dcfcbb1fd97544f..000cb53b34a48d0d7c39e6386c51fe6437a3c169 100644
--- a/examples/hello-uniapp/common/uni.css
+++ b/examples/hello-uniapp/common/uni.css
@@ -861,4 +861,29 @@ radio-group label, checkbox-group label{
.uni-tab-bar-loading{
padding:20upx 0;
-}
\ No newline at end of file
+}
+
+/* steps */
+.uni-steps{padding:20upx 30upx; flex-grow: 1; display:flex; flex-wrap:wrap;}
+.uni-steps view{display:flex; flex-wrap:wrap; float:none;}
+.uni-steps .step{width:31.3%; margin:0 1%; flex-wrap:nowrap;}
+.uni-steps .step-circle{width:50upx; height:50upx; border-radius:50upx; background:#F1F1F3; justify-content:center; line-height:50upx; flex-shrink:0; margin-right:15upx; color:#666; font-size:28upx;}
+.uni-steps .step-content{width:100%; height:22upx; border-bottom:1px solid #F1F2F3;}
+.uni-steps .step-title{line-height:50upx; height:50upx; background:#FFFFFF; width:auto; overflow:hidden; padding-right:8upx;}
+.uni-steps .current .step-circle{background:#00B26A; color:#FFFFFF;}
+.uni-steps .current .step-content{border-color:#00B26A;}
+.uni-steps .current .step-title{color:#00B26A;}
+
+/* uni-comment */
+.uni-comment{padding:5rpx 0; display: flex; flex-grow:1; flex-direction: column;}
+.uni-comment-list{flex-wrap:nowrap; padding:10rpx 0; margin:10rpx 0; width:100%; display: flex;}
+.uni-comment-face{width:70upx; height:70upx; border-radius:100%; margin-right:20upx; flex-shrink:0; overflow:hidden;}
+.uni-comment-face image{width:100%; border-radius:100%;}
+.uni-comment-body{width:100%;}
+.uni-comment-top{line-height:1.5em; justify-content:space-between;}
+.uni-comment-top text{color:#0A98D5; font-size:24upx;}
+.uni-comment-top text:last-child{color:#666666;}
+.uni-comment-date{line-height:38upx; flex-direction:row; justify-content:space-between; display:flex !important; flex-grow:1;}
+.uni-comment-date view{color:#666666; font-size:24upx; line-height:38upx;}
+.uni-comment-content{line-height:1.6em; font-size:28upx; padding:8rpx 0;}
+.uni-comment-replay-btn{background:#FFF; font-size:24upx; line-height:28upx; padding:5rpx 20upx; border-radius:30upx; color:#333 !important; margin:0 10upx;}
\ No newline at end of file
diff --git a/examples/hello-uniapp/components/mpvue-citypicker/mpvueCityPicker.vue b/examples/hello-uniapp/components/mpvue-citypicker/mpvueCityPicker.vue
index 01b1441f282b7964fab627189ef1a14223cdc19f..2a0416c31e138e35bec472974484f20a215f7549 100644
--- a/examples/hello-uniapp/components/mpvue-citypicker/mpvueCityPicker.vue
+++ b/examples/hello-uniapp/components/mpvue-citypicker/mpvueCityPicker.vue
@@ -33,32 +33,38 @@ export default {
pickerValue: [0, 0, 0],
provinceDataList: [],
cityDataList: [],
- areaDataList: []
+ areaDataList: [],
+ /* 是否显示控件 */
+ showPicker: false,
};
},
created() {
- this.handPickValueDefault(); // 对 pickerValueDefault 做兼容处理
- this.provinceDataList = provinceData;
- this.cityDataList = cityData[this.pickerValueDefault[0]];
- this.areaDataList =
- areaData[this.pickerValueDefault[0]][this.pickerValueDefault[1]];
- this.pickerValue = this.pickerValueDefault;
+ this.init()
},
props: {
- /* 是否显示控件 */
- showPicker: {
- type: Boolean,
- default: false
- },
/* 默认值 */
pickerValueDefault: {
type: Array,
- default: [0, 0, 0]
+ default(){
+ return [0, 0, 0]
+ }
},
/* 主题色 */
themeColor: String
},
+ watch:{
+ pickerValueDefault(){
+ this.init();
+ }
+ },
methods: {
+ init() {
+ this.handPickValueDefault(); // 对 pickerValueDefault 做兼容处理
+ this.provinceDataList = provinceData;
+ this.cityDataList = cityData[this.pickerValueDefault[0]];
+ this.areaDataList = areaData[this.pickerValueDefault[0]][this.pickerValueDefault[1]];
+ this.pickerValue = this.pickerValueDefault;
+ },
show() {
setTimeout(() => {
this.showPicker = true;
diff --git a/examples/hello-uniapp/components/mpvue-picker/mpvuePicker.vue b/examples/hello-uniapp/components/mpvue-picker/mpvuePicker.vue
index 8a0123ba7f1176fd1e5a89ef04467cf7f3258052..dd988296f9e67f25fc78787cb1d5a779a75956f2 100644
--- a/examples/hello-uniapp/components/mpvue-picker/mpvuePicker.vue
+++ b/examples/hello-uniapp/components/mpvue-picker/mpvuePicker.vue
@@ -78,7 +78,9 @@
pickerValueMulTwoTwo: [],
pickerValueMulThreeOne: [],
pickerValueMulThreeTwo: [],
- pickerValueMulThreeThree: []
+ pickerValueMulThreeThree: [],
+ /* 是否显示控件 */
+ showPicker: false,
};
},
props: {
@@ -87,20 +89,19 @@
type: String,
default: 'selector'
},
- /* 是否显示控件 */
- showPicker: {
- type: Boolean,
- default: false
- },
/* picker 数值 */
pickerValueArray: {
type: Array,
- default: []
+ default(){
+ return []
+ }
},
/* 默认值 */
pickerValueDefault: {
type: Array,
- default: []
+ default(){
+ return []
+ }
},
/* 几级联动 */
deepLength: {
@@ -116,7 +117,10 @@
},
mode(oldVal, newVal) {
this.modeChange = true;
- }
+ },
+ pickerValueArray(val){
+ this.initPicker(val);
+ }
},
methods: {
initPicker(valueArray) {
diff --git a/examples/hello-uniapp/pages/template/comments/comments.vue b/examples/hello-uniapp/pages/template/comments/comments.vue
index 10bb4df34ef9414132d0b8504e6ed9af718066b5..9ff42e1a610489f1663b9fac9857f2f752d372ca 100755
--- a/examples/hello-uniapp/pages/template/comments/comments.vue
+++ b/examples/hello-uniapp/pages/template/comments/comments.vue
@@ -13,7 +13,6 @@
@@ -23,7 +22,6 @@
@@ -33,7 +31,6 @@
@@ -61,25 +57,15 @@
diff --git a/examples/hello-uniapp/pages/template/mpvue-picker/mpvue-picker.vue b/examples/hello-uniapp/pages/template/mpvue-picker/mpvue-picker.vue
index fa9ce1669c1957442ec5c7300c10077681030f44..114340e3225a9111e750e7d21f2947cda0c6bd37 100644
--- a/examples/hello-uniapp/pages/template/mpvue-picker/mpvue-picker.vue
+++ b/examples/hello-uniapp/pages/template/mpvue-picker/mpvue-picker.vue
@@ -34,7 +34,6 @@
data() {
return {
title : "mvpue-picker 使用示例",
- pickerValueDefault: [0, 0],
pickerSingleArray: [{
label: '中国',
value: 1
@@ -58,7 +57,8 @@
pickerText: '',
mode: '',
deepLength: 1,
- pickerValueDefault: [0]
+ pickerValueDefault: [0],
+ pickerValueArray:[]
};
},
methods: {
diff --git a/examples/hello-uniapp/pages/template/steps/steps.vue b/examples/hello-uniapp/pages/template/steps/steps.vue
index 692b94c0f16c3074afcb6b1e178a07b8de44e116..db5a4cca83156a3f996ad28542c00d395be339bd 100755
--- a/examples/hello-uniapp/pages/template/steps/steps.vue
+++ b/examples/hello-uniapp/pages/template/steps/steps.vue
@@ -27,21 +27,14 @@
\ No newline at end of file